Where to Find the Best Real Estate Agents in Portugal
Alright, you know what to look for. Now, where do you find these best real estate agents in Portugal? Let's explore the key avenues. Firstly, online portals and directories are a great starting point. Websites like Idealista, Imovirtual, and Rightmove often feature listings from a wide range of agents. You can browse properties and read reviews to get a sense of an agent's reputation. Filter your search by location, property type, and price range to narrow down your options. However, remember that not all agents are created equal, so do your research and read reviews carefully before reaching out. Secondly, real estate agencies are a primary source. Many international and local real estate agencies operate in Portugal. Researching these agencies can be a good idea. Consider the agency's reputation, area of expertise, and the range of services they offer. Visit their website, read client testimonials, and check their social media presence. Agencies can often connect you with experienced agents who specialize in your desired location or property type.
Then you have personal referrals. The most reliable way to find a great agent is often through a personal recommendation from someone you trust, such as friends, family members, or colleagues who have recently purchased property in Portugal. Ask them about their experience with the agent, the quality of service they received, and whether they would recommend them to others. Personal referrals can provide valuable insights and give you peace of mind. Fourthly, local networking is also a good choice. If you're spending time in Portugal, attending local events, or connecting with expat communities can be a great way to meet agents. This gives you the opportunity to chat with potential agents in person and get a feel for their personality and expertise. Also, don't underestimate the power of social media! Search for real estate agents in Portugal on platforms like LinkedIn and Facebook. You can often find agents who are active in their communities and share valuable market insights.
Another approach is to attend property fairs and exhibitions. These events offer an opportunity to meet agents face-to-face, learn about available properties, and gather information about the market. You can also attend seminars and workshops to gain a better understanding of the buying process. Finally, be sure to check reviews and testimonials. Before committing to an agent, always research their online reviews and read testimonials from previous clients. Look for consistent positive feedback regarding their professionalism, communication, and negotiation skills. Check platforms like Google Reviews, Facebook, and specialized real estate review sites. This can provide valuable insights into their strengths and weaknesses. Be wary of agents with a consistently poor rating.

The Buying Process: How Agents Help
So, how do the best real estate agents in Portugal help you through the actual buying process? Let's take a look. First things first, they will start with a property search and selection. They will work with you to understand your needs and preferences, including your budget, desired location, property type, and other criteria. Then, they will use their network and resources to identify properties that match your specifications. They will then schedule and accompany you on property viewings, providing valuable insights and advice. Secondly, a very crucial part is negotiation and offer management. Once you've found a property you love, your agent will help you prepare and submit an offer to the seller. They will then negotiate on your behalf to secure the best possible price and terms. They will handle all communications with the seller or their agent, keeping you informed throughout the process.
Then comes the legal and administrative support. Your agent will connect you with a qualified lawyer or solicitor who can assist you with the legal aspects of the purchase. They will help you review contracts, ensure all paperwork is in order, and guide you through the closing process. They can also coordinate with other professionals, such as notaries, surveyors, and inspectors. Another important task is managing the paperwork and deadlines. Your agent will keep track of all the paperwork and deadlines associated with the purchase. They will ensure that everything is submitted on time and that all requirements are met. They will also assist you with obtaining necessary documents, such as a fiscal number (NIF) and opening a Portuguese bank account. They provide ongoing support beyond the closing. Even after the sale is complete, your agent can be a valuable resource. They can connect you with local service providers, provide property management advice, or simply be a point of contact for any questions you may have. It's a long-term relationship built on trust and expertise. Finally, they provide localized insights. Agents possess a deep understanding of local market trends, property values, and potential investment opportunities. They will use this information to provide you with insights into the best areas to invest in and the properties that are likely to appreciate in value.
Avoiding Common Pitfalls
Buying property in a foreign country can be exciting, but it also comes with potential pitfalls. Here's how a top real estate agent in Portugal can help you avoid them. First off, lack of due diligence. One of the most common mistakes is failing to conduct proper due diligence before making an offer. This includes verifying the property's legal status, checking for any outstanding debts or encumbrances, and ensuring that all necessary permits and licenses are in place. A good agent will guide you through this process, helping you avoid potential legal and financial issues down the line. Next, there is the overpaying for property. It's easy to get caught up in the excitement of a purchase and overpay for a property. A skilled agent will have a good understanding of market values and will be able to advise you on a fair price. They can also help you negotiate with the seller to secure the best possible deal. Then comes failing to understand local laws and regulations. Portuguese real estate laws can be complex. You need to ensure you fully understand all legal aspects of the purchase, including taxes, property registration, and zoning regulations. Your agent will work with legal professionals to ensure your purchase complies with all Portuguese laws.
Next, underestimating the costs. Buying property involves more than just the purchase price. You also need to factor in other costs, such as taxes, legal fees, notary fees, and property registration fees. A good agent can help you estimate these costs and ensure you're prepared for all expenses. Also, not having a clear budget can be a big issue. It's essential to have a clear and realistic budget before you start your property search. This includes not only the purchase price but also all associated costs. A good agent will work with you to determine your budget and help you find properties that fit your financial profile. Another common mistake is skipping the inspection. It's crucial to have a professional inspection carried out on the property before you make an offer. This will help you identify any potential problems, such as structural damage, plumbing issues, or electrical faults. Your agent can recommend qualified inspectors and arrange for the inspection to be carried out. Finally, choosing the wrong agent. Not all agents are created equal. Choosing an inexperienced or unethical agent can lead to a host of problems. Do your research, check references, and interview multiple agents before making a decision.
